What is an Internship Azure Data Scientist?

An Internship Azure Data Scientist is an entry-level or student role that involves working with data science tools and techniques on Microsoft Azure's cloud platform. Interns in this position typically assist with data analysis, machine learning model development, and data pipeline creation using Azure services such as Azure Machine Learning, Data Factory, and Databricks. The internship provides hands-on experience with cloud-based data science workflows and helps interns build practical skills for a career in data science. Responsibilities may include cleaning and preparing data, training models, and visualizing results to support business decisions. This role is ideal for students or recent graduates interested in cloud computing and analytics.

What is the difference between Internship Azure Data Scientist vs Data Analyst Intern?

AspectInternship Azure Data ScientistData Analyst Intern
Required SkillsAzure cloud services, basic data science, programming (Python, R), machine learning fundamentalsData visualization, SQL, Excel, basic statistical analysis
Work EnvironmentTech companies, cloud-focused teams, project-basedBusiness teams, reporting, data cleaning and analysis
CertificationsAzure Fundamentals, basic data science coursesNone typically required, basic Excel/SQL knowledge

Internship Azure Data Scientist roles focus on applying machine learning and cloud-based data science techniques using Azure services, often in tech or cloud-centric environments. Data Analyst Interns primarily handle data cleaning, visualization, and reporting tasks within business contexts. While both roles require foundational data skills, Azure Data Scientist internships emphasize cloud and machine learning expertise, whereas Data Analyst Internships focus on data interpretation and presentation.

What types of projects and responsibilities can I expect as an Azure Data Scientist intern?

As an Azure Data Scientist intern, you'll typically work on data-driven projects such as developing machine learning models, preparing and cleaning datasets, and performing exploratory data analysis using Microsoft Azure tools. You'll likely collaborate closely with data engineers, software developers, and senior data scientists to integrate solutions into cloud environments. Interns often participate in regular team meetings, present findings, and may contribute to optimizing existing data pipelines. This hands-on experience provides a strong foundation for a future career in cloud-based data science roles.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Internship Azure Data Scientist,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Internship Azure Data Scientist, you need foundational knowledge in statistics, data analysis, and programming languages such as Python or R, often supported by coursework or a degree in a STEM field. Familiarity with Microsoft Azure cloud services, data modeling tools, and machine learning frameworks is typically expected, and certifications like Microsoft Certified: Azure Data Scientist Associate can be beneficial. Strong problem-solving abilities, eagerness to learn, and effective communication skills help interns collaborate and convey technical findings clearly. These skills ensure interns can contribute meaningfully to data-driven projects while adapting quickly to the evolving demands of cloud-based analytics environments.

Job description

Honeywell is looking for a data driven professional to join its Data Science engineering team to design & build in-house as well as evaluate and integrate 3rd party analytical components. You will develop new innovative solutions, evaluate & integrate 3rd party solutions, and deploy state-of-the-art AI-ML models and data mining techniques that leverage physical access control system datasets to unlock new security insights for end-user customers.

Do you enjoy integrating systems together, mashing-up datasets and analyzing them by leveraging state-of-the-art data mining, generative AI, and ML techniques to drive decision making?  As an Advanced Data Scientist, you will be responsible for data engineering, leveraging closed and open-source LLMs, text and multi-modal embedding models, and development of new generative AI systems and ML models to deliver analytical systems that improve forensic and real-time security outcomes.  These analytical systems you develop in-house and those integrated from 3rd parties will extend the capabilities of our core product ecosystems. 

Honeywell helps organizations solve the world's most complex challenges in automation, the future of aviation and energy transition. As a trusted partner, we provide actionable solutions and innovation through our Aerospace Technologies, Building Automation, Energy and Sustainability Solutions, and Industrial Automation business segments - powered by our Honeywell Forge software - that help make the world smarter, safer and more sustainable.

YOU MUST HAVE

  • BS or MS in an appropriate technology field (Computer Science, Statistics, Applied Math, etc.)
  • 5+ years of experience in modern advanced analytical tools and programming languages, including Python with scikit-learn
  • Proficiency with exploratory data analysis
  • Proficiency with ETL operations sourcing data from SQL, REST APIs, and flat files
  • Experience with data visualization technologies, such as Power BI, Tableau, matplotlib, Excel, etc.
  • 5+ years of experience in traditional programming languages such as Python, JavaScript, TypeScript, C++, or C#
  • Comfortable in Windows and Linux environments

WE VALUE

  • Experience in building generative AI applications leveraging embeddings, LLMs, VLMs, vector databases, data source APIs, and agentic patterns/frameworks
  • Experience in various deployment topologies including on-premises, hybrid, and cloud for production generative AI applications
  • Experience in building predictive and decision-making AI applications.
  • Experience using cloud services from AWS, Azure, or GCP to develop solutions.
  • Experience in computer vision and image/video analysis, including object detection, recognition, tracking, and identification
  • Experience with application of data mining algorithms and statistical modeling techniques such as clustering, classification, regression, decision trees, neural networks, SVMs, anomaly detection, recommender systems, pattern discovery, and text mining
  • Problem Solving: Ability to solve problems using analytical thinking, reconciling viewpoints, and evaluating technologies.
  • Communication: Demonstrates effective verbal and written communication skills when explaining complex technical issues to both technical and non-technical audiences
  • Continuous learning mindset

THE BUSINESS UNIT


Honeywell Building Automation (BA) is a leading global provider of products, software, solutions, and technologies that enable building owners and occupants to ensure their facilities are safe, energy efficient, sustainable, and productive. BA products and services include advanced software applications for building control and optimization; sensors, switches, control systems, and instruments for energy management; access control; video surveillance; fire products; and installation, maintenance, and upgrades of systems. Revenues in 2022 for BA were $6B and there are approximately 18,000 employees globally. To learn more, please visit https://buildings.honeywell.com/
